比特幣與以太坊的技術差異與發展趨勢解析

比特幣與以太坊的技術差異與發展趨勢解析

一、比特幣與以太坊的技術差異與發展趨勢解析

過去十多年來,區塊鏈技術引領了金融與科技領域的創新,而比特幣(Bitcoin, BTC)與以太坊(Ethereum, ETH)則是其中最具代表性的兩大巨頭。比特幣被視為「數位黃金」,主要作為一種去中心化的價值儲存與交易媒介;而以太坊則是一個強大的智能合約平台,能夠支援去中心化應用(DApps),使其具備更廣泛的使用場景。

雖然比特幣與以太坊同屬於區塊鏈技術的應用,但它們在技術設計、運作機制和發展方向上皆存在顯著差異。在這篇文章中,我們將深入探討比特幣與以太坊的技術差異,包括共識機制、交易速度、智能合約功能等。此外,我們也會分析這兩者未來的發展趨勢,以幫助讀者更全面地理解這兩種主流加密貨幣的特性與潛在機會。

二、比特幣的技術架構

比特幣(Bitcoin)是最早出現的加密貨幣,其技術架構奠定了區塊鏈的基礎。比特幣的核心技術包括分散式帳本(區塊鏈)、工作量證明(PoW)共識機制、未花費交易輸出(UTXO)模型以及強大的安全設計等。在這一部分,我們將介紹比特幣的技術原理及其運作方式。

區塊鏈技術概述

比特幣的區塊鏈是一個公開、分散的帳本,記錄所有交易數據。其主要特點包括:

  • 去中心化: 由全球節點共同維護,無需中央機構。
  • 不可篡改: 交易經過驗證後被記錄在鏈上,難以更改。
  • 透明性: 任何人都可查閱區塊鏈上的交易紀錄,提高信任度。

比特幣的區塊鏈運作方式是將交易資料打包成區塊,並透過共識機制來確認與添加到鏈上。

工作量證明(PoW)機制

比特幣使用工作量證明(Proof of Work, PoW)作為共識機制,確保網絡的運行與安全。PoW 的運作方式如下:

  1. 礦工透過計算哈希值來解決加密難題。
  2. 解出正確哈希值的礦工獲得記錄交易的權利,並新增區塊到區塊鏈中。
  3. 此過程確保交易的誠實性及區塊鏈的完整性。

雖然 PoW 機制提供了高安全性,但也面臨高能耗與礦工壟斷的問題。

UTXO 模型的交易方式

比特幣使用 UTXO(未花費交易輸出)模型來管理交易帳戶,與傳統的餘額模型不同,其運作方式如下:

特點 說明
交易輸入(Input) 來自過去未花費的比特幣(UTXO)。
交易輸出(Output) 產生新的 UTXO,供未來交易使用。
交易驗證 透過數字簽名驗證交易合法性。

這種機制提高了交易透明度,避免「雙重支付」問題,確保比特幣網絡的完整性。

比特幣的安全性設計

為了確保交易與網絡安全,比特幣採用了多重安全設計:

  • 非對稱加密: 透過公鑰與私鑰進行交易簽名,防止偽造交易。
  • 分散式網絡: 節點共同維護區塊鏈,減少單點故障風險。
  • 防止雙重支付: 利用 PoW 機制與 UTXO 模型確保交易唯一性。

這些設計確保比特幣網絡的健全性,使其成為全球最安全的區塊鏈之一。

以太坊的技術架構

三、以太坊的技術架構

以太坊的技術架構與比特幣有明顯不同,它不僅是一種加密貨幣,更是一個能夠支援各種去中心化應用(DApps)的智慧合約平台。以太坊透過圖靈完備的虛擬機(EVM)運行智能合約,並有不同於比特幣的賬戶模型與共識機制。

智能合約——去中心化應用的基礎

智能合約是以太坊相較於比特幣最大的技術突破之一。簡單來說,智能合約是一組自動執行的數字合約,當條件滿足時便會自動執行。這讓開發者能夠建立無需中介的應用程式,例如去中心化金融(DeFi)、NFT 市場等。

智能合約的特點

  • 自行執行:不需要人工干預,一旦部署,便會按照程式碼執行。
  • 不可篡改:一旦合約上鏈,就無法更改,提高了信任度。
  • 透明性:所有人都可以查看智能合約的程式碼,確保透明度。

圖靈完備的以太坊虛擬機(EVM)

以太坊虛擬機(EVM)是以太坊的核心,它允許開發者使用 Solidity 等程式語言編寫智能合約。EVM 是圖靈完備的,這意味著它具備執行任何計算邏輯的能力,而這也是以太坊能夠支援各種應用的原因。

EVM 與比特幣腳本的比較

特性 以太坊 EVM 比特幣腳本
運行環境 智能合約的執行環境 僅限於交易驗證
支持邏輯 圖靈完備,可執行複雜運算 非圖靈完備,僅支持基本運算
用途 支援 DApp、NFT、DeFi 主要用於交易支付

賬戶模型與共識機制的演進

以太坊的賬戶模型與比特幣的 UTXO 模型不同,它使用更直覺的「賬戶餘額」方式來管理資產。此外,在早期,以太坊與比特幣一樣採用了 PoW 共識機制,但最終轉向了 PoS(權益證明)。

以太坊的賬戶模型

以太坊採用「賬戶模型」,這意味著每個地址持有的資產是以餘額的形式呈現,而不是像比特幣那樣透過 UTXO 進行追蹤。這讓以太坊的交易設計更類似於傳統銀行帳戶,提高了運算效率。

從 PoW 到 PoS 的轉變

以太坊最初使用與比特幣相同的工作量證明(PoW),但隨著以太坊 2.0 的上線,開始過渡到權益證明(PoS)。

PoW 與 PoS 的比較
特性 PoW(工作量證明) PoS(權益證明)
能源消耗 高,需要大量計算資源 低,無需礦機計算
安全性 高度安全,但可能受 51% 攻擊影響 更難攻擊,提高去中心化程度
交易速度 較慢 更快

以太坊遷移至 PoS 的主要目標是提升效率,同時降低能耗,這讓以太坊在環保與可擴展性方面更具優勢。

四、比特幣與以太坊的核心技術差異

比特幣(Bitcoin)與以太坊(Ethereum)是兩種最具代表性的區塊鏈技術,但它們在核心技術細節上存在許多差異,包括共識機制、資料結構、智能合約、擴展性與安全性等方面。以下是它們的主要技術區別解析。

共識機制

比特幣與以太坊的共識機制雖然都曾使用過 PoW(工作量證明),但以太坊已經在 2022 年的「合併(The Merge)」升級過渡到 PoS(權益證明)。這對於交易處理速度、能源消耗以及網路安全性產生了巨大影響。

技術面向 比特幣 以太坊
共識機制 PoW(工作量證明) PoS(權益證明,自 Ethereum 2.0 起)
能源消耗 高,需要大量計算資源 低,相較於 PoW 需求較少的計算資源
節點參與 挖礦者透過計算競爭出塊權 持有以太幣並質押的用戶可參與驗證與打包交易

資料結構

在區塊鏈運作中,資料結構的設計至關重要。比特幣的交易資料主要以 UTXO(未花費交易輸出)模型運作,而以太坊則使用帳戶餘額(Account-based)模式,這影響了交易驗證與執行方式。

  • 比特幣(UTXO 模型): 交易輸出在被花費後不能再次使用,可提高隱私性但處理智能合約較為不便。
  • 以太坊(帳戶模型): 交易基於帳戶餘額,較適合執行智能合約,但在部分應用上可能較容易產生雙重支付風險。

智能合約

比特幣的區塊鏈主要用於交易,而以太坊則開創「智能合約」概念,允許開發者為去中心化應用(DApp)撰寫並執行程式碼。

技術面向 比特幣 以太坊
智能合約支援 有限(Bitcoin Script,可執行簡單條件) 強大(支援 Turing 完整的 Solidity 語言)
應用範圍 主要用於交易、儲值 可用於 DeFi、NFT、DAO 等多種應用
靈活性 較低 較高

擴展性

擴展性是區塊鏈發展的一大挑戰,影響交易處理速度與網路效率。比特幣主要透過閃電網路(Lightning Network)提供擴展能力,而以太坊則使用 Layer 2 方案,例如 Rollups 技術。

  • 比特幣擴展性方案: 閃電網路提供即時支付功能,但仍在持續發展。
  • 以太坊擴展性方案: L2 方案(Optimistic Rollup、ZK-Rollup)有效降低交易成本並提高 TPS。

安全性

比特幣與以太坊均採取加密技術確保交易安全,但由於其網路結構與應用不同,面臨的安全性風險也有所不同。

技術面向 比特幣 以太坊
51% 攻擊風險 PoW 需要龐大算力,攻擊成本高 PoS 依賴持倉量,但仍可能出現攻擊風險
智能合約漏洞 無智能合約,風險低 智能合約易遭攻擊,開發者需審計程式碼
安全機制 較穩定但功能簡單 功能強大但可能存在漏洞

總結來說,比特幣與以太坊的技術設計有顯著不同。比特幣側重於去中心化、安全性與儲值價值,而以太坊則致力於建立可程式化的區塊鏈環境。這些技術差異使它們各自適用於不同的區塊鏈應用場景。

五、未來發展趨勢

隨著比特幣與以太坊的發展逐漸成熟,兩者在技術擴展方面也面臨不同的挑戰與機遇。比特幣主要專注於強化其可擴展性與支付功能,而以太坊則致力於提升交易效率與智能合約的運行能力。以下我們將分析兩者的技術發展方向及其未來應用前景。

比特幣的第二層擴展方案:閃電網路

閃電網路(Lightning Network)概述

比特幣的區塊鏈由於設計上的限制,交易處理速度較慢,手續費在網絡繁忙時容易飆升。為了解決這個問題,「閃電網路」作為比特幣的第二層解決方案應運而生。

閃電網路的核心概念是透過建立「支付通道」,允許用戶在比特幣主鏈外進行多次交易,最後將最終交易結果提交至主鏈。這種方式不但降低了交易成本,也大幅提高了交易速度。

閃電網路的優勢與挑戰

優勢 挑戰
提高交易速度 使用者體驗有待提升
降低交易手續費 節點運行依賴性強
支援小額支付 資金鎖定問題

儘管閃電網路解決了比特幣的部分可擴展性問題,但仍然面臨流動性管理及用戶體驗不足的挑戰。未來,如果更多的企業與支付平台支持閃電網路,其普及程度將進一步提升。

以太坊的擴容方案:Rollups 與分片技術

Rollups——鏈下計算,鏈上記錄

Rollups 是以太坊目前主要推動的擴容技術之一,它將大量交易計算移至鏈下,只將最終的交易結果記錄在以太坊主鏈上,從而減少主鏈的負擔。Rollups 分為 Optimistic Rollups 和 ZK-Rollups 兩種類型。

類型 工作原理 優勢 挑戰
Optimistic Rollups 假設所有交易都是正確的,只有在爭議時才進行驗證 計算成本較低,兼容 EVM 欺詐證明(Fraud Proof)機制可能導致提款延遲
ZK-Rollups 使用零知識證明技術,確保交易數據的正確性 交易確認速度快,安全性高 與 EVM 兼容性較低,開發門檻高

分片技術(Sharding)——提升網絡吞吐量

分片技術的核心目標是將以太坊網絡劃分為多個「分片」,每個分片能夠處理自己的交易與合約執行,從而並行運行,極大提升以太坊的吞吐量。目前,分片技術計畫與以太坊 2.0 的升級同步推進,預計將在未來幾年內逐步實現。

未來應用前景與挑戰

比特幣與支付應用的融合

閃電網路的發展使比特幣更適用於日常支付,未來可能被更多商家與國際支付平台採用。然而,目前的用戶體驗仍有待優化,如何讓普通用戶更容易使用閃電網路將是關鍵。

以太坊與去中心化應用(DApps)的發展

隨著 Rollups 和分片技術逐步落地,以太坊的交易速度與成本問題將有望得到解決。這將促進更多去中心化金融(DeFi)、NFT 及 Web3 應用的發展,吸引更多開發者與企業進入生態系統。

技術挑戰與監管變數

無論是比特幣還是以太坊,在未來的發展中都將面臨技術挑戰與全球監管框架的變化。例如,閃電網路的普及仍依賴於更好的流動性解決方案,而以太坊的擴容技術仍須不斷調整,以保持去中心化與安全性的平衡。此外,各國政府對於加密貨幣的監管政策仍在演變,未來政策變動將對這些技術的推廣產生影響。